## Tuning the generator

When customers complain that Gridlewick takes forever to fill a puzzle, it's almost always the backtracking budget, not the word list. Bigger grids need more retries, and themed lists shrink the search space a lot. Bump the budget before suggesting a smaller grid — that's usually the fix. The knobs live in one config block, reproduced here for quick reference.

tuning constants:
RATE_LIMITS = {
    "wenwyn": 1,
    "zorix": 10,
    "oliix": 2,
    "holael": 10,
}

- [ ] Idempotency keys for payment retries (Tollgate service). Confirm every retry path — client timeout, gateway 5xx, webhook replay — reuses the original key rather than minting a new one. Keys persist 72h in the Brindle store; verify TTL config matches staging. Duplicate-charge canary must run green for 24h before signoff. Mira owns rollback. Double-submit tests live in the settlement suite and must pass on the candidate build, which is recorded below for the audit trail.

trace token, bajof-fahif: htk21_7f5ed969de03e4870a26f

The Fernley Partner Programme launches next quarter across three tiers. Resellers purchase Quillstone licences at tiered discounts and invoice end customers directly. Finance implications: revenue recognised at sell-in, with a rebate accrual for volume thresholds settled quarterly. Margin floors are fixed; exceptions require sign-off from the commercial controller. Expect roughly forty partners at launch, concentrated in the Westbrook corridor.

The confidential note appended below outlines the commercial strategy behind the tier structure.

board note of bawep-tajef: Queniusek Systems plans to raise the Quenvan list price by 53.1 percent in March. The pricing group signed off on a budget of $176.4 million for Project Drueth. The renewal with Casionix Partners closes at $142.5 million a year, 8.3 percent below the last contract. Project Fraax slips by six weeks because of the tooling delay.